Dhinguli - Kumarsain, Shimla

Dhinguli is a village situated in the Kumarsain tehsil of Shimla district, Himachal Pradesh. It is located approximately 90 km from Shimla. Zar serves as the Gram Panchayat for Dhinguli village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Dhinguli is 023860. The village covers a total geographical area of 57 hectares and falls under the 172027 pincode. Narkanda is the nearest town.

Dhinguli village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Theog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Shimla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Dhinguli

As per Census 2011, Dhinguli village has a total population of 93 people, consisting of 53 males and 40 females. The village has 22 households and a sex ratio of 754 females per 1,000 males. There are 6 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 79 literate and 14 illiterate residents.
